London: Methuen, 1902. First edition. Hardcovers. Large octavos. Two volumes. xviii + 308pp. + 40pp. ads; xii + 374pp. + 40pp. ads. Red cloth gilt-lettered on spines & front boards. Index. Frank Podmore (1856-1910) was one of the ablest and most balanced contemporary critics of Spiritualism. He wrote widely on the subject in this important work which was later published under the title 'Mediums of the 19th Century.' It remains his best-known work, and is arguably one of the best critical histories of the subject ever undertaken: it was described by E. J. Dingwall as "the most important general history of the subject ever written and for the period with which it deals is not likely to be surpassed." From the collection of Dr. M. H. Coleman, with his ex-libris seal blind-stamped on the front free endpaper of both volumes. Light rubbing to cloth overall, corners and spine ends lightly bumped and chafed, spines a bit sunned, some light browning and foxing to page edges, endpapers and text pages, tiny abrasion to cloth at upper front gutter volume II, otherwise a tight, clean and internally unmarked VG set. Scarce. Item #61488
